The Habit Loop: Cue, Routine, Reward in Everyday Life

Charles Duhigg’s concept of the habit loop—cue, routine, reward—applies universally. For example, the cue “waking up” triggers the routine “drink a glass of water,” reinforced by the reward “hydration and alertness.” By designing intentional loops, we turn beneficial actions into automatic responses, aligning habits with desired outcomes.

Designing Effective Small Habits: Practical Principles

Creating sustainable habits demands intentional design. The most effective strategies minimize friction and leverage environmental cues.

The 2-Minute Rule

Popularized by James Clear, starting with a 2-minute version of a habit—like putting on workout shoes or writing one sentence—lowers resistance. Once begun, momentum often leads to full execution. This rule exploits the power of identity: “I’m someone who moves” rather than “I want to exercise.”

Environment Shaping

Our surroundings dictate behavior. Placing a water bottle on the desk cues hydration; keeping a journal by the bed invites reflection. Environmental design reduces decision fatigue and aligns daily choices with long-term goals. Avoid temptations—remove distractions, amplify positive triggers.

Tracking and Feedback

Measuring progress without overwhelm fosters consistency. A habit tracker, whether digital or paper, visualizes growth and reinforces commitment. Studies show visual feedback increases adherence by 30%. Pair tracking with reflection to deepen awareness and adjust strategies.

The Role of Identity Shifts: From “I want to” to “I am”

Effective habit formation redefines self-identity. “I want to run” becomes “I am a runner.” This shift transforms behavior from effortful to automatic. Research in social psychology shows identity-based habits have 3x higher completion rates, as actions become expressions of who we are.

Avoiding Decision Fatigue by Simplifying Choices

Decision fatigue undermines self-control—each choice drains mental reserves. By embedding habits into routine, we reduce the need for constant deliberation. Batch similar decisions, automate defaults, and keep choices simple. This preserves willpower for high-stakes decisions, enhancing overall life quality.
